On , OSHA opened a planned safety inspection of JOVAL MANUFACTURING COMPANY, INC. in 120 IRIS AVENUE, JEFFERSON, LA 70121 (NAICS 332322). OSHA activity number 340588797.
O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1910.147(c)(6)(i): Periodic inspection. The employer shall conduct a periodic inspection of the energy control procedure at least annually to ensure that the procedure and the requirements of this standard are being followed: On or about April 23, 2015 the employer did not ensure that periodic inspections of the energy control procedures were performed on an annual basis to verify that the procedures were adequate to protect employees from all hazards and that the requirements of the standard were being followed.

General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1910.95(d)(1): When information indicated that any employee's exposure equaled or exceed the 8-hour time-weighted average of 85 decibels, the employer did not develop and implement a monitoring program: On or about April 23, 2015 the employer did not ensure that a monitoring program had been developed and implemented to evaluate employees' exposure to noise who are required to wear hearing protection per a hearing conservation program.

General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1910.95(g)(6): At least annually after obtaining the baseline audiogram, the employer did not obtain a new audiogram for each employee exposed at or above an 8-hour time-weighted average of 85 decibels: On or about April 23, 2015 the employer did not ensure that employees under the hearing conservation program were subject to an annual audiogram after their initial baseline audiogram.
